Who We are

We are an independent business led by brother and sister team, Philip and Rebecca Rayner on our family farm, north of Huntingdon, in Cambridgeshire. At Glebe Farm Foods, oats are more than just a crop – they are our obsession, our passion, and our way of life. We take great pride in delivering the highest quality and purest British gluten free oats, supplying customers and manufacturers right around the world. From field, to farm to food, we meticulously handle every step of the process, from growing to processing, to ensure unparalleled quality. Under our PureOaty brand, we offer a range of tOATtally tasty products, including oat drinks, granolas, and porridges, made with unwavering dedication to quality ingredients and sustainability, all certified 100% gluten free by Coeliac UK. 

the responsibilities

Content Management
Develop and manage diverse content including social media posts, blog articles, email newsletters, video content, managing freelancers and agencies for content creation and production. Tailor content to engage our B2C audience with recipes, educational content, and behind-the-scenes glimpses, inform our B2B audience with business updates and product insights. Direct creative processes in line with brand guidelines and campaign plans. 

Digital Communications
Manage social media accounts, creating content calendars, scheduling posts, community management and tracking key metrics . Manage B2C engagement on Instagram and consider expansion into TikTok, as well as manage B2B communications through LinkedIn and email newsletters. Develop collaborations with complimentary brands, engage with influencers to enhance brand visibility and manage paid social campaigns

Digital Channel Management
Manage our Direct to Consumer website and Amazon storefront. Optimise product pages with compelling descriptions and images to increase conversion rates. Enhance the website’s customer experience, overseeing content management and analytics in partnership with a digital agency, prioritising engagement metrics. 

Customer Marketing
Support the sales team with trade marketing activities for foodservice, wholesale and independent retail channels. Manage development and activation of point of sale, trade media adverts, brochures, leaflets and customer presentations. 

Event Coordination
Support the Head of Marketing with creative designs for B2B and B2C events, oversee logistics and supplier relations, and actively participate in events to bolster brand presence and customer engagement. 

Packaging Coordination
Direct the creation of packaging artwork, ensuring alignment with brand and technical standards. Facilitate approval processes and ensure design accuracy. 

Marketing Collateral
Manage the inventory of marketing materials including leaflets, brochures, and branded merchandise like bags, mugs, and clothing, ensuring they are in line with brand standards and readily available for marketing initiatives. 

Budget Management
Responsible for monitoring and managing marketing budgets for various projects. Ensure that all marketing activities are executed within allocated budgets, raise PO’s, track expenditure and report monthly to optimise financial resources.
